Subway Tile

Subway tile refers to a rectangular shaped tile that was first introduced in New York’s subway stations. Traditionally they are white and measure 3 inches by 6 inches in size but have expanded over the years to include slimmer and larger formats, along with a wide array of colors and finishes. Subway tile is typically laid in a brick pattern but can be arranged to create a variety of patterns.
